Instats is excited to offer a 1-day seminar, R for Beginners (part 2) – 
Visualizing, Summarizing, and Exploring Data 
<https://instats.org/seminar/r-for-beginners-part-2---visualizing-sum>, 
livestreaming June 19 (Europe) and led by the team at SMCS from the UC Louvain. 
Designed for researchers looking to strengthen their data-analytic toolkit, 
this hands-on workshop shows you how to harness R’s open-source power to 
conduct exploratory data analysis, compute key descriptive statistics such as 
means, medians, ranges, correlations, variances, skewness, and kurtosis, and 
create compelling graphics—from histograms, boxplots, and scatter plots to QQ 
plots, violin plots, mosaic plots, and Pareto charts. You’ll master the 
principles of effective visualization, learn to spot patterns and anomalies in 
complex datasets, and emerge ready to transform raw data into clear, actionable 
insights that guide informed research decisions.
